Well, Texas Tech softball fans are probably still trying to figure out if what they saw at Tracy Sellers Field this afternoon actually happened. In a game that was essentially over, with upwards of 90 degree heat, the Texas Tech Red Raiders made the case for fans to stay until the absolute last play.
When facing the Ole Miss Rebels, Texas Tech stumbled along through 6.2 innings. The Red Raiders found themselves down 8-0 with just one out remaining in the bottom of the seventh inning. And instead of sitting in misery and self-pity, the Texas Tech softball team managed to pull off a historic comeback that had never been seen before.Â
The Red Raiders became the first team in NCAA softball tournament history to come back from being down eight or more runs in the seventh inning.
A string of timely hits, some singles, and some home runs (including a grand slam) put the Red Raiders on top 10-9 in the bottom of the eighth inning. In the seventh inning alone, with two outs, down 8-0, the Red Raiders managed to score eight runs to tie things up. Despite everything, Texas Tech won.
